Страница 1 из 1

Kincony KC-868_A6

Добавлено: 11 авг 2025, 23:24
DenDenDen
Здравствуйте. Есть проблема, прошивки через flprog 9.5.1 не работает управление реле на плате kincony kc868-A6. Может кто сталкивался. Реле работает, проверенно родной прошивкой.

Re: Kincony KC-868_A6

Добавлено: 12 авг 2025, 06:53
Aviacode
Вы проверьте другой версией, например, седьмой, а то может быть, адрес расширителя просто неправильно указали.

Re: Kincony KC-868_A6

Добавлено: 12 авг 2025, 06:55
Phazz
DenDenDen писал(а): 11 авг 2025, 23:24 Здравствуйте. Есть проблема, прошивки через flprog 9.5.1 не работает управление реле на плате kincony kc868-A6. Может кто сталкивался. Реле работает, проверенно родной прошивкой.
Обновите до последней версии, там это должно было исправлено

Re: Kincony KC-868_A6

Добавлено: 12 авг 2025, 07:32
cmept-27
Phazz писал(а): 12 авг 2025, 06:55
DenDenDen писал(а): 11 авг 2025, 23:24 Здравствуйте. Есть проблема, прошивки через flprog 9.5.1 не работает управление реле на плате kincony kc868-A6. Может кто сталкивался. Реле работает, проверенно родной прошивкой.
Обновите до последней версии, там это должно было исправлено
Можешь не обновлять не работает там у kincony kc868-A6 не чего. DS1302 тоже не работают
KIKONY RELE.flp
Так пробуй
Библиотека PCF8574_library.zip

Re: Kincony KC-868_A6

Добавлено: 12 авг 2025, 07:44
Phazz
cmept-27 писал(а): 12 авг 2025, 07:32
Phazz писал(а): 12 авг 2025, 06:55
DenDenDen писал(а): 11 авг 2025, 23:24 Здравствуйте. Есть проблема, прошивки через flprog 9.5.1 не работает управление реле на плате kincony kc868-A6. Может кто сталкивался. Реле работает, проверенно родной прошивкой.
Обновите до последней версии, там это должно было исправлено
Можешь не обновлять не работает там у kincony kc868-A6 не чего. DS1302 тоже не работают

KIKONY RELE.flp Так пробуй
Библиотека PCF8574_library.zip
Проверяли?

Re: Kincony KC-868_A6

Добавлено: 12 авг 2025, 07:48
cmept-27
Phazz писал(а): 12 авг 2025, 07:44
cmept-27 писал(а): 12 авг 2025, 07:32
Phazz писал(а): 12 авг 2025, 06:55

Обновите до последней версии, там это должно было исправлено
Можешь не обновлять не работает там у kincony kc868-A6 не чего. DS1302 тоже не работают

KIKONY RELE.flp Так пробуй
Библиотека PCF8574_library.zip
Проверяли?
Проверял. l2C тоже не работает.
Простой экран только вручную присоединил сменив в коде

Wire.begin();
на
Wire.begin(4,15);

Re: Kincony KC-868_A6

Добавлено: 12 авг 2025, 08:55
DenDenDen
cmept-27 писал(а): 12 авг 2025, 07:32
Phazz писал(а): 12 авг 2025, 06:55
DenDenDen писал(а): 11 авг 2025, 23:24 Здравствуйте. Есть проблема, прошивки через flprog 9.5.1 не работает управление реле на плате kincony kc868-A6. Может кто сталкивался. Реле работает, проверенно родной прошивкой.
Обновите до последней версии, там это должно было исправлено
Можешь не обновлять не работает там у kincony kc868-A6 не чего. DS1302 тоже не работают

KIKONY RELE.flp Так пробуй
Библиотека PCF8574_library.zip
Спасибо, сработало 👍

Re: Kincony KC-868_A6

Добавлено: 12 авг 2025, 10:22
Ander
В версии выше 9-5-7 реле работает, ожидайте появления бета версии.

Re: Kincony KC-868_A6

Добавлено: 13 авг 2025, 10:57
ABVch
Всем кто хочет, чтоб заработал Kincony - I2c работает в этом контроллере на пинах 4 и 15 (по схеме), а в файле RT_HW_PLC_KC868_A6.hpp шина определена как RT_HW_Base.i2cSetPins(4,5,0); замените 5 на 15 и будет у всех счастье. Сам долго ковырял и искал где это определяется. Нужно исправить файлы и в других контроллерах этого производителя. Загружать модулем (платой) "FLProg: ESP32S-Dev_Module".
Подключил дисплей SSD1306 - тоже работает/
Проверил WEB интерфейс - работает/
А, забыл, проверяю на версии 9.5.5 на инсталяшке.
Проверил работу входов - работают, только надо учитывать по умолчанию не замкнутый никуда вход DI выдает "1", замыкание на GND - "0". В алгоритмах надо предусматривать инверсию изначально.
Встроенные часы - проверил, работают. Батарейку не вставлял, просто её нет.

С аналоговыми входами остались вопросы, по их количеству. Первого входа нет во всплывающем меню, хотя физически и по схеме он есть.
Кто с этим вопросом разобрался прошу озвучить, может автор этого приложения контроллера даст разъяснения.
Единственное что успел сегодня за целый день это в файле RT_HW_PLC_KC868_A6.hpp найти ошибку в строке определения аналогового входа AI4 в строке uint8_t pinAin4=33(35); RT_HW_PIN_ADC_ID ain4; заменить 33 на 35, тогда будет правильно работать 4 аналоговый вход. А первого входа я пока не нашел где в каком месте его надо определить.

Re: Kincony KC-868_A6

Добавлено: 14 авг 2025, 12:42
ABVch
Разобрался почему нет первого аналогового входа CH1 (0-5V) и что делает вход с названием "Вход".
Я переделал данный контроллер с образца текущего и добавил CH1 - работает.
стал разбираться как работает "Вход" повесив его на pin 36, как и первый вход - он показал те-же значения что и CH1. Вывод - подключив номер пин входа и определив какого типа будет выход его можно использовать в алгоритмах.
Хорошо бы это было прописано в описании к этому контроллеру, но вход CH1 я бы все равно сделал/

Re: Kincony KC-868_A6

Добавлено: 14 авг 2025, 14:05
Ander
ABVch писал(а): 14 авг 2025, 12:42 Разобрался почему нет первого аналогового входа CH1 (0-5V) и что делает вход с названием "Вход".
Я переделал данный контроллер с образца текущего и добавил CH1 - работает.
стал разбираться как работает "Вход" повесив его на pin 36, как и первый вход - он показал те-же значения что и CH1. Вывод - подключив номер пин входа и определив какого типа будет выход его можно использовать в алгоритмах.
Хорошо бы это было прописано в описании к этому контроллеру, но вход CH1 я бы все равно сделал/
Выложите сделанное вами описание контроллера. Посмотрим, заменим.

Re: Kincony KC-868_A6

Добавлено: 14 авг 2025, 14:22
ABVch
Ander писал(а): 14 авг 2025, 14:05
ABVch писал(а): 14 авг 2025, 12:42 Разобрался почему нет первого аналогового входа CH1 (0-5V) и что делает вход с названием "Вход".
Я переделал данный контроллер с образца текущего и добавил CH1 - работает.
стал разбираться как работает "Вход" повесив его на pin 36, как и первый вход - он показал те-же значения что и CH1. Вывод - подключив номер пин входа и определив какого типа будет выход его можно использовать в алгоритмах.
Хорошо бы это было прописано в описании к этому контроллеру, но вход CH1 я бы все равно сделал/
Выложите сделанное вами описание контроллера. Посмотрим, заменим.
2 файла во вложении. *.hpp положить взамен c:\Program Files (x86)\FLProg\ideV8\portable\sketchbook\libraries\RT_HW_32_EXPANDERS_PLC\
*.sixx положить по умолчанию как в настройках программы c:\Users\Alex\AppData\Roaming\flprog\

Re: Kincony KC-868_A6

Добавлено: 14 авг 2025, 14:27
Ander
ABVch писал(а): 14 авг 2025, 14:22
Ander писал(а): 14 авг 2025, 14:05
ABVch писал(а): 14 авг 2025, 12:42 Разобрался почему нет первого аналогового входа CH1 (0-5V) и что делает вход с названием "Вход".
Я переделал данный контроллер с образца текущего и добавил CH1 - работает.
стал разбираться как работает "Вход" повесив его на pin 36, как и первый вход - он показал те-же значения что и CH1. Вывод - подключив номер пин входа и определив какого типа будет выход его можно использовать в алгоритмах.
Хорошо бы это было прописано в описании к этому контроллеру, но вход CH1 я бы все равно сделал/
Выложите сделанное вами описание контроллера. Посмотрим, заменим.
2 файла во вложении. *.hpp положить взамен c:\Program Files (x86)\FLProg\ideV8\portable\sketchbook\libraries\RT_HW_32_EXPANDERS_PLC\
*.sixx положить по умолчанию как в настройках программы c:\Users\Alex\AppData\Roaming\flprog\
Можно экспортировать описание одного контроллера из самой программы, так правильнее.

Re: Kincony KC-868_A6

Добавлено: 14 авг 2025, 14:30
ABVch
ABVch писал(а): 14 авг 2025, 14:22
Ander писал(а): 14 авг 2025, 14:05
ABVch писал(а): 14 авг 2025, 12:42 Разобрался почему нет первого аналогового входа CH1 (0-5V) и что делает вход с названием "Вход".
Я переделал данный контроллер с образца текущего и добавил CH1 - работает.
стал разбираться как работает "Вход" повесив его на pin 36, как и первый вход - он показал те-же значения что и CH1. Вывод - подключив номер пин входа и определив какого типа будет выход его можно использовать в алгоритмах.
Хорошо бы это было прописано в описании к этому контроллеру, но вход CH1 я бы все равно сделал/
Выложите сделанное вами описание контроллера. Посмотрим, заменим.
2 файла во вложении. *.hpp положить взамен c:\Program Files (x86)\FLProg\ideV8\portable\sketchbook\libraries\RT_HW_32_EXPANDERS_PLC\
*.sixx положить по умолчанию как в настройках программы c:\Users\Alex\AppData\Roaming\flprog\
тут тестовый проект

Re: Kincony KC-868_A6

Добавлено: 14 авг 2025, 14:36
ABVch
Ander писал(а): 14 авг 2025, 14:27
ABVch писал(а): 14 авг 2025, 14:22
Ander писал(а): 14 авг 2025, 14:05

Выложите сделанное вами описание контроллера. Посмотрим, заменим.
2 файла во вложении. *.hpp положить взамен c:\Program Files (x86)\FLProg\ideV8\portable\sketchbook\libraries\RT_HW_32_EXPANDERS_PLC\
*.sixx положить по умолчанию как в настройках программы c:\Users\Alex\AppData\Roaming\flprog\
Можно экспортировать описание одного контроллера из самой программы, так правильнее.
Да, во вложении
Только текст я не правил, для этого надо ещё время провести для тестов. К сожалению надо ещё и работу параллельно делать.
Впрочем, если будут пожелания и отзывы, можно и заняться...

Re: Kincony KC-868_A6

Добавлено: 30 сен 2025, 15:52
CraCk
Как обстоят сейчас дела с DS1302 на KC-868-A6? Хочу прикупить, и сделать автономный таймер освещения и обогрева курятника, с конфигурацией через ВЕБ морду.

Re: Kincony KC-868_A6

Добавлено: 01 окт 2025, 14:11
ecoins
CraCk писал(а): 30 сен 2025, 15:52 Как обстоят сейчас дела с DS1302 на KC-868-A6? Хочу прикупить, и сделать автономный таймер освещения и обогрева курятника, с конфигурацией через ВЕБ морду.
Прикупите. Это и сейчас решается штатными средствами, но как-то наверное встроим.
Очень уж DS1307 древний и не точный. Если только регулярно обновлять через NTP-Server.

Re: Kincony KC-868_A6

Добавлено: 01 окт 2025, 20:16
Aviacode
CraCk писал(а): 30 сен 2025, 15:52 Как обстоят сейчас дела с DS1302 на KC-868-A6? Хочу прикупить, и сделать автономный таймер освещения и обогрева курятника, с конфигурацией через ВЕБ морду.
У меня работает

Re: Kincony KC-868_A6

Добавлено: 02 окт 2025, 09:20
CraCk
ecoins писал(а): 01 окт 2025, 14:11 Очень уж DS1307 древний и не точный. Если только регулярно обновлять через NTP-Server.
Думаю если ошибка в пару минут на месяц, не страшно, куры не обидятся))). В новой версии платы уже нормальные часы, но цена не адекватная. Синхронизации через NTP-Server невозможна, так как нет wifi сети. Только возможно как то автоматически при подключении телефона к плате, в крайнем случае вручную.